Estou à procura de uma opção ou de uma solução alternativa onde eu possa aceitar ou rejeitar o Conteúdo TCP com base no tamanho do ficheiro que está a ser enviado Esta configuraçãoénecessária apenas na camada TCP IP também tentámos opções como req_len(não funciona ), bem como src_kbytes_in (funciona bem somente após o compartilhamento da primeira solicitação), se alguém puder me ajudar nisso, ficarei grato.
Responder1
A camada TCP não sabe nada sobre arquivos e seus tamanhos. Não tem nada a ver com isso. TCP é uma camada de transporte 4, enquanto os arquivos são transferidos usando a camada de aplicação 7 (ou seja, HTTP/HTTPS). Portanto, sua pergunta não tem sentido devido a isso.
Além do afaik, o haproxy também não sabe nada sobre arquivos. Funciona como um proxy e não lida com uploads de arquivos. É o servidor backend que deve se preocupar com os limites de upload de arquivos. Se você usar uploads de arquivos padrão HTTP(S) POST, consulte a documentação do servidor web sobre como limitar o tamanho máximo de upload HTTP(S).
EDIT: além disso, dê uma olhada nesta resposta sobre o haproxy não lidar com limites de upload:https://stackoverflow.com/questions/46820640/increase-the-upload-limit-of-haproxy